Gildan Activewear re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$0.43, sur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.4006 by 7.34%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in this release. The stock responded with a modest increase of 0.05 points, reflecting cautious market reaction to the positive earnings surprise.

Gildan Activewear’s stronger-than-expected EPS for the first quarter of 2026 highlights effective cost management and operational discipline despite a challenging macroeconomic environment. The company continues to focus on its core printwear and branded apparel segments, leveraging its vertical manufacturing model to maintain margin resilience. Although specific revenue details were not provided, the 7.34% earnings surprise suggests that gross margins may have benefited from stable input costs and efficient inventory management. Gildan’s ongoing investment in automation and supply chain optimization likely contributed to lower overheads, supporting profitability. The activewear market remains competitive, with demand trends influenced by retailers’ inventory destocking and cautious consumer spending. However, Gildan’s position as a low-cost producer and its strong distribution network have enabled the company to protect earnings during this period. The reported EPS also indicates that the company may have realized gains from product mix improvements or share repurchases, though these factors were not explicitly confirmed.

No formal guidance was provided with this release, but the earnings beat may signal management’s confidence in the company’s operating trajectory. Gildan likely continues to prioritize cash flow generation, debt reduction, and shareholder returns through dividends or buybacks. Risks remain, including potential volatility in cotton prices, labor availability, and shifts in apparel demand if economic conditions weaken. The company may also face currency headwinds given its international sales exposure. On the strategic front, Gildan has been streamlining its brand portfolio and expanding into sustainable product lines, which could support long-term growth. The positive earnings surprise might give management more flexibility to invest in marketing or capacity expansion while maintaining margin targets. Investors should watch for further clarity on revenue performance and full-year expectations when the company reports its next quarterly results. Any slowdown in end-market demand could pressure future earnings, but the current report suggests operational resilience.

The stock’s minimal gain of 0.05 following the announcement indicates that investors may have already priced in a slight beat or are awaiting more context on revenue trends. Analysts may view the EPS surprise as a positive sign of cost control, but the lack of revenue disclosure leaves uncertainty about top-line momentum. Some analysts could raise estimates for the next quarter, given the better-than-expected profitability. However, without sales data, the market might remain cautious until more comprehensive metrics are available. Key factors to watch include upcoming retailer orders, input cost trends, and any commentary on holiday-season demand. If Gildan can sustain this margin performance while revenue stabilizes, the stock could see more upward movement. Conversely, any signs of margin compression or demand weakness would likely temper enthusiasm. For now, the company’s ability to exceed EPS expectations demonstrates execution strength, but investors should monitor broader apparel industry indicators and Gildan’s next report for a fuller picture of financial health.
